AT THE APEX OF Meaning and Definition

  1. "At the apex of" is an idiomatic expression that conveys the idea of being at the highest or most important point or position of something. The term "apex" originates from the Latin word "apex" meaning "summit" or "peak". When used in a figurative sense, it refers to the pinnacle or culmination of a certain aspect, often indicating the most successful or influential period or individual within a particular field or organization.

    To be "at the apex of" something implies occupying the leading or topmost position relative to others, whether it be in terms of power, influence, success, reputation, or any other relevant factor. It signifies a dominant or superior position that stands above others within a hierarchy or categorization. The phrase is often applied to describe an individual, organization, or concept that possesses unparalleled levels of achievement or expertise.

    For example, one could state that a particular company is "at the apex of the technology industry" to illustrate that it is the most innovative, influential, and successful entity within that field. Similarly, an artist might be described as "at the apex of their career" if they are experiencing the highest level of acclaim, recognition, and achievement within their profession.

    Overall, "at the apex of" is a phrase used to highlight the topmost, most superior, or most influential position within a specific context, emphasizing the pinnacle of achievement or dominance.
